body {background:url(bkg_level2.jpg) repeat-x bottom left; margin:0; text-align:center;
         font: 12px Arial, Helvetica, Sans-Serif; color: #65552e;}

body.level2 {background:url(bkg_level2.jpg) repeat-x bottom left; background-color: #FFFFFF;}
			
h1, h2, h3, h4, h5 {color:#87b302; display:block; margin:0; padding:0;}
h1 {color:#87b302; font: 26px Verdana, Arial, Sans-Serif; display:block; margin:0; padding:0;}
h3 {color:#87b302; font: 14px Arial, Sans-Serif; font-weight:bold;display:block;}


a {color:#584925; text-decoration:underline}

a:hover {color:#3366ccw; text-decoration:underline}

#page {text-align:left; margin:auto; padding-left:0px; width:960px;}


ul.navTop {
	margin:0 12px  0 0; padding:0; font: 11px Arial, Helvetica, sans-serif; color: #5e5131; list-style: none;
}
ul.navTop li{
	display:inline;
	padding:4px 8px 4px 12px; 
	background-image: url(bullet_brown_sm.gif);
	background-repeat: no-repeat;
	background-position: 0 9px;
}
	
ul.navTop li.first{
	background: none;
}
.navTop a {
	color: #5e5131; text-decoration:none;
}
.navTop a:hover {
	text-decoration:underline;
}

ul.menu {
	margin:0; padding:0; font: 15px Arial, Helvetica, sans-serif; color: #65552e; list-style: none; 
}
ul.menu li{
	display:inline;
	padding:4px 20px 4px 16px; 
	background-image: url(bullet_green.gif);
	background-repeat: no-repeat;
	background-position: 0 9px;
}

.menu a {
	color: #584925; text-decoration:none; font-weight:bold;
}
.menu a:hover {
	color: #3366cc; text-decoration:none; font-weight:bold;
}


ul.navLeft {
	margin:12px 0 34px 4px; padding:0; font: 14px Arial, Helvetica, sans-serif; color: #756232; list-style: none;
}
ul.navLeft li{
	padding:4px 0 4px 16px; 
	background-image: url(arrow_green.gif);
	background-repeat: no-repeat;
	background-position: 0 9px;
}
	
.navLeft a {
	color: #756232; text-decoration:none; font-weight:bold;
}

.navLeft a:hover {
	color: #3366cc; text-decoration:none; font-weight:bold;
}

.partnering {
 width:120px; margin-top:8px;
 font-size:12px; color:#5e5337;font-weight:bold;line-height:1.35;
}

.partnering a {
 font-size:12px; font-weight:bold; color:#5e5337; text-decoration:underline; line-height:1.35;
}

.partnering a:hover {
 font-size:12px; font-weight:bold; color:#3366cc; text-decoration:underline; line-height:1.35;
}

p { font-size:13px; line-height:17px; color:#584925; margin:6px 0 0 0; padding:6px 0 0 0;}
p.FontBold { font-weight:bold;}

.product td {text-align:center; padding-bottom:12px;}
.product a {font-size:13px; font-weight:bold;}

#main {margin:20px 0 0 0; padding:0;}

#footer {color:#816b33; margin:-24px 0 0 0;}

.level2 #footer{margin-bottom:60px;}
.level2 .product {margin-bottom:40px;}

